Top 10 Questions for River Rat Interview

Essential Interview Questions For River Rat

1. How do you validate the quality of your data before it is ingested into your data warehouse?

To ensure data quality before ingestion, I follow a comprehensive validation process:

  • Data Profiling: I analyze data distribution, identify outliers, and check for missing or invalid values to assess data integrity.
  • Schema Validation: I verify that data conforms to the defined schema, ensuring consistency and adherence to data standards.
  • Data Cleansing: I apply data cleansing techniques to correct errors, remove duplicates, and handle missing values to improve data reliability.
  • Referential Integrity Checks: I check relationships between tables to ensure data integrity and prevent inconsistencies.
  • Data Transformation: I perform necessary data transformations to align data with the required format and structure for warehousing.

2. What are the different types of data transformations you have performed in your previous role?

Data Cleaning and Preparation

  • Removed duplicate records
  • Filled missing values using imputation techniques
  • Standardized data formats and corrected data inconsistencies

Data Manipulation

  • Reshaped data using pivoting and unpivoting
  • Joined data from multiple sources using SQL queries
  • Created calculated fields and derived new insights from existing data

3. How do you handle large datasets that exceed the memory capacity of a single machine?

To handle large datasets, I leverage various techniques:

  • Data Partitioning: I divide large datasets into smaller, manageable chunks to process them efficiently.
  • Distributed Processing: I utilize distributed computing frameworks like Hadoop or Spark to process data across multiple machines.
  • Cloud-Based Solutions: I leverage cloud platforms like AWS or Azure, which provide scalable infrastructure and data processing capabilities.
  • Data Sampling: When dealing with massive datasets, I use data sampling techniques to extract representative subsets for analysis.

4. Can you describe your experience with data visualization tools?

I am proficient in various data visualization tools, including:

  • Tableau: I have extensive experience creating interactive dashboards and visualizations for data exploration and analysis.
  • Power BI: I am skilled in using Power BI to connect to data sources, create data models, and generate reports and visualizations.
  • Plotly: I am familiar with Plotly for creating dynamic and interactive web-based visualizations.
  • Python Libraries: I utilize Python libraries like Matplotlib and Seaborn for data visualization and exploratory data analysis.

5. How do you approach data analysis and modeling for a specific business problem?

My approach to data analysis and modeling involves the following steps:

  • Problem Definition: I clarify the business problem and define the specific objectives of the analysis.
  • Data Exploration: I explore the available data to understand its characteristics and identify potential patterns or insights.
  • Data Preparation: I clean and prepare the data to ensure its quality and suitability for analysis.
  • Model Selection: I select appropriate data analysis or modeling techniques based on the business problem and data characteristics.
  • Model Building and Evaluation: I develop and evaluate models using appropriate metrics to assess their performance and accuracy.
  • Insights and Recommendations: I interpret the results of the analysis and provide actionable insights and recommendations to address the business problem.

6. Can you explain the concept of data lineage and why it is important in data management?

Data lineage refers to the history and origin of data, tracking its journey from source to destination.

  • Data Quality: It helps identify data dependencies and impact analysis, ensuring data integrity and quality.
  • Data Governance: It supports data governance initiatives by providing a clear understanding of data ownership and accountability.
  • Regulatory Compliance: It aids in meeting regulatory requirements such as GDPR and HIPAA by tracking data usage and lineage.
  • Data Debugging: It simplifies data debugging by allowing quick identification of data issues and their root causes.
  • Data Analytics: It enhances data analysis by providing context and understanding of data transformations and calculations.

7. What is the difference between supervised and unsupervised machine learning algorithms?

Supervised learning algorithms require labeled data to train a model that can predict outcomes or classify data points. Examples include:

  • Linear Regression: Predicts continuous numerical values
  • Logistic Regression: Predicts binary outcomes
  • Decision Tree: Classifies data into multiple categories

Unsupervised learning algorithms work with unlabeled data to identify patterns or structures. Examples include:

  • Clustering: Groups similar data points together
  • Dimensionality Reduction: Reduces the number of features in a dataset
  • Anomaly Detection: Identifies unusual or outlier data points

8. Can you explain the significance of feature engineering in machine learning?

Feature engineering is a crucial process that involves transforming and creating new features from raw data to enhance machine learning model performance.

  • Improve Data Quality: Cleanses and preprocesses data to remove noise and inconsistencies.
  • Enhance Model Understanding: Creates meaningful features that are easier for models to interpret and process.
  • Boost Model Performance: Optimizes features to improve model accuracy, precision, and recall.
  • Reduce Overfitting: Prevents models from learning overly complex patterns by creating generalizable features.
  • Speed Up Training: Selects and transforms features efficiently, reducing training time and computational resources.

9. What are the key considerations for selecting the right cloud platform for data warehousing?

  • Scalability: Platform should support the ability to handle large and growing data volumes.
  • Reliability: Platform should provide high availability and fault tolerance to ensure data accessibility.
  • Cost-Effectiveness: Platform should offer flexible pricing models to optimize costs based on usage and storage needs.
  • Security: Platform should meet security requirements for data protection and access control.
  • Integration: Platform should seamlessly integrate with existing data sources and analytics tools.

10. How do you stay updated with the latest advancements in data science and technology?

  • Online Courses and Certifications: Enrolling in online courses and pursuing certifications to acquire new skills and knowledge.
  • Conferences and Webinars: Attending industry events and webinars to learn about cutting-edge technologies and best practices.
  • Research Papers: Reviewing academic and industry research papers to stay informed about new algorithms and methodologies.
  • Online Communities and Forums: Participating in online communities and forums to engage with peers and discuss industry trends.
  • Technical Blogs and Publications: Reading technology blogs and industry publications to keep abreast of the latest advancements.

Interviewers often ask about specific skills and experiences. With ResumeGemini‘s customizable templates, you can tailor your resume to showcase the skills most relevant to the position, making a powerful first impression. Also check out Resume Template specially tailored for River Rat.

Career Expert Tips:

  • Ace those interviews! Prepare effectively by reviewing the Top 50 Most Common Interview Questions on ResumeGemini.
  • Navigate your job search with confidence! Explore a wide range of Career Tips on ResumeGemini. Learn about common challenges and recommendations to overcome them.
  • Craft the perfect resume! Master the Art of Resume Writing with ResumeGemini’s guide. Showcase your unique qualifications and achievements effectively.
  • Great Savings With New Year Deals and Discounts! In 2025, boost your job search and build your dream resume with ResumeGemini’s ATS optimized templates.

Researching the company and tailoring your answers is essential. Once you have a clear understanding of the River Rat‘s requirements, you can use ResumeGemini to adjust your resume to perfectly match the job description.

Key Job Responsibilities

River Rats are highly-skilled professionals responsible for executing complex operations in challenging marine environments. Their primary duties include:

1. Vessel Maintenance and Repair

Maintain, repair, and upgrade boats, docks, and other marine infrastructure.

  • Conduct regular inspections for safety and functionality
  • Perform mechanical repairs on engines, electrical systems, and plumbing

2. Marine Construction

Construct, install, and repair marine structures, such as docks, piers, and bridges.

  • Operate heavy machinery and tools for pile driving, welding, and excavation
  • Ensure structural integrity and compliance with building codes

3. Underwater Inspection and Repair

Dive underwater to inspect and repair marine structures, equipment, and vessels.

  • Use specialized equipment and techniques for underwater welding, cutting, and cleaning
  • Assess damage, determine repair requirements, and execute repairs

4. Emergency Response

Respond to marine emergencies, including search and rescue operations, boat fires, and environmental spills.

  • Operate emergency response vessels and equipment
  • Collaborate with law enforcement and other agencies to ensure safety

Interview Tips

To ace an interview for a River Rat position, follow these essential tips:

1. Research the Industry and Company

Familiarize yourself with the marine construction industry, specific techniques used by the company, and their recent projects.

  • Visit the company’s website and LinkedIn page for information
  • Read industry news and publications to gain insights

2. Highlight Relevant Skills and Experience

Emphasize your proficiency in boat handling, construction techniques, diving abilities, and emergency response procedures.

  • Quantify your experience with specific examples and numbers
  • Showcase your adaptability and willingness to learn new skills

3. Demonstrate Physical and Mental Toughness

River Rats require exceptional physical strength and endurance, as well as strong mental fortitude.

  • Discuss your previous experience working in physically demanding environments
  • Emphasize your ability to handle stress and make quick decisions

4. Prepare for Technical Questions

Expect technical questions related to boat repair, construction methods, diving techniques, and marine safety protocols.

  • Review common marine equipment, construction materials, and industry acronyms
  • Practice answering questions about troubleshooting and safety procedures
Note: These questions offer general guidance, it’s important to tailor your answers to your specific role, industry, job title, and work experience.

Next Step:

Armed with this knowledge, you’re now well-equipped to tackle the River Rat interview with confidence. Remember, a well-crafted resume is your first impression. Take the time to tailor your resume to highlight your relevant skills and experiences. And don’t forget to practice your answers to common interview questions. With a little preparation, you’ll be on your way to landing your dream job. So what are you waiting for? Start building your resume and start applying! Build an amazing resume with ResumeGemini.

River Rat Resume Template by ResumeGemini
Disclaimer: The names and organizations mentioned in these resume samples are purely fictional and used for illustrative purposes only. Any resemblance to actual persons or entities is purely coincidental. These samples are not legally binding and do not represent any real individuals or businesses.
Scroll to Top